From Red Wings to red tape: Pavel Datsyuk grounded

Pavel Datsyuk is awaiting paperwork before he officially segues into the next chapter of his hockey career.

“We are waiting on a transfer card from Arizona and we expect it to arrive shortly,” Dan Milstein, Datsyuk's agent, told the Free Press today. “As soon as we get that, Pavel will sign with one of the KHL clubs.”

SKA St. Petersburg is believed to be front-runner. Datsyuk is expected to sign a two-year deal worth 250 million rubles annually -- equivalent to $3.8 million.

The longtime Detroit Red Wings superstar was traded to Arizona on June 24, in a move that gave the Coyotes a way to inflate their payroll and gave the Wings room to make the most of theirs.
